Main purpose of the Role:

BGC Partners / Cantor Fitzgerald require a credit analyst to undertake counterparty credit reviews on existing and new clients including recommendation of trading limits and internal ratings.

The role also includes servicing brokers and responding in a timely fashion to broker requests.

Counterparties comprise a diverse range of entities including banks, hedge funds and investment managers. In order to meet the requirements of the role the credit analyst also require understanding of and to have had experience in various financial market products such as equities, fixed income, derivatives and structured products.

Key Responsibilities
  • Completion of credit risk assessment reports for new client proposals including recommendation of trading limits
  • Ongoing risk analysis of the existing client portfolio and preparation of line review reports
  • Lead role in working with Risk IT to develop and enhance existing risk processes and on periodic generation and distribution of Broker Risk reports specific to Desk requirements
  • Lead role in the credit aspect review and enhancement of the firm's existing trading platforms and the onboarding of new electronic platforms
  • Limit monitoring including escalation of credit breaches or temporary limit requirements
  • Presentation at the credit committee meeting of client proposals that require discussion and assisting in the credit committee documentation process, sourcing research and industry material
  • Facilitate real time broker requests and produce one-off credit approvals in a timely manner
  • Corresponding to external clients in relation to information and documentation requests
  • Taking a lead role in new client set ups and maintenance of static data integrity
  • Keeping a high level global viewpoint of the market and alerting management of any events that may give rise to meaningful changes in credit files
  • Keeping on top of file and information management particularly in relation to email flow
  • Assisting the team by taking on ad-hoc projects as and when required.
